/// <summary>
 /// Deprecated Method for adding a new object to the jobs EntitySet. Consider using the .Add method of the associated ObjectSet&lt;T&gt; property instead.
 /// </summary>
 public void AddTojobs(job job)
 {
     base.AddObject("jobs", job);
 }
 /// <summary>
 /// Create a new job object.
 /// </summary>
 /// <param name="job_id">Initial value of the job_id property.</param>
 /// <param name="template_id">Initial value of the template_id property.</param>
 /// <param name="geosite_id">Initial value of the geosite_id property.</param>
 /// <param name="jobtype_id">Initial value of the jobtype_id property.</param>
 /// <param name="jobstatus_id">Initial value of the jobstatus_id property.</param>
 /// <param name="redo">Initial value of the redo property.</param>
 /// <param name="buildname">Initial value of the buildname property.</param>
 /// <param name="accepted">Initial value of the accepted property.</param>
 /// <param name="start_time">Initial value of the start_time property.</param>
 /// <param name="end_time">Initial value of the end_time property.</param>
 /// <param name="branch_id">Initial value of the branch_id property.</param>
 public static job Createjob(global::System.Decimal job_id, global::System.Int64 template_id, global::System.Int32 geosite_id, global::System.Int32 jobtype_id, global::System.Int64 jobstatus_id, global::System.Boolean redo, global::System.String buildname, global::System.Boolean accepted, global::System.DateTimeOffset start_time, global::System.DateTimeOffset end_time, global::System.Int64 branch_id)
 {
     job job = new job();
     job.job_id = job_id;
     job.template_id = template_id;
     job.geosite_id = geosite_id;
     job.jobtype_id = jobtype_id;
     job.jobstatus_id = jobstatus_id;
     job.redo = redo;
     job.buildname = buildname;
     job.accepted = accepted;
     job.start_time = start_time;
     job.end_time = end_time;
     job.branch_id = branch_id;
     return job;
 }